It’s called El Camino del Rey.

You are given a hikers eye view as you go up a mountain trail. You start the hike by stepping on metal pegs which are embedded in the side of the mountain. And for added balance, there are handholds. Hang on for your life!

Each step can be riddled with extreme danger. This is after all a hike not for the feint of heart…This may be the world’s scariest hiking trail.

What was most amazing to me is that at points in the hike there are acutally stairs. I had to wonder, who would build these…and why.

Also there are parts of the hike which is paved. These are paved portions which are basically being held in mid air. Then you come to a part of the hike which has been washed out…

Rube Goldberg Biography

Rube Goldberg (1883-1970) was a Pulitzer Prize winning cartoonist, sculptor, and author.

Reuben Lucius Goldberg (Rube Goldberg) was born in San Francisco on July 4th, 1883. After graduating University of California Berkeley with a degree in engineering, Rube went on to work as an engineer for the City of San Francisco Water and Sewers Department.

After six months Rube shifted gears and left the Sewers Department to become an office boy in the sports department of a San Francisco newspaper. While there he began to submit drawings and cartoons to the editor until he was finally published. Rube soon moved from San Francisco to New York to work for the Evening Mail drawing daily cartoons. This led to syndication and a national presence – and the rest is history

Sadly Beau will not be doing any more riding… The biker is Beau Forrest. The video is a tribute to him.
He was only 18 when died. He was hanging out with friends, near a lake, when he decided to go for a swim. He just got up and jumped backwards into a lake. Unfortunately the water was very shallow…

Here is how his father described it:

“He was with his mates reminiscing about old times, he didn’t drink, he didn’t like beer.
‘He said “I am going for a swim” and got up.
‘Nobody saw Beau dive into the pool although, due to the nature of his injuries, we believe he jumped into the shallow water backwards.”
